Output 5fda21962ed083e30c86e788d6d6b24a749556ebaea017ef2f6d994884437549:1

value
2554482667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49828df32424d1f93f945b699a9eb9ed1c898916 OP_EQUAL
address
38PheddqRp3WJ8Dht3G8f6czd8uxNcUiJY
transaction
5fda21962ed083e30c86e788d6d6b24a749556ebaea017ef2f6d994884437549
confirmations
375812
spent
true